Una Healy hints at future The Saturdays reunion

Una Healy, former member of the girl group The Saturdays has recently shared her feelings on a possible reunion with her bandmates, and it sounds like good news.

Their reunion won’t be happening anytime soon!

Speaking to RTE Una said, “It’s all about timing and I think that now would be a little bit too soon for us to come back together.

“But I hope that the day will come and I would be delighted to get back together with the girls.”

But do they keep in contact? Una said, “We hang out when we can and keep in touch all the time on the Whatsapp group,” aww we love to hear all the gals are still friends!
